Fleet Marston, nestled in Aylesbury Vale, has seen a variety of home sales over the years. The most expensive house in this charming area fetched a remarkable £762,500 in 2016, while the least expensive sold for £90,250. Since 1998, there have been 12 sales, with the latest transaction occurring in 2025. Interestingly, 8 of these properties are located on the same street, A41, Townsend Piece, highlighting a sense of community in this picturesque locale.
